Brief summary
The primary objective of this treatment review and feedback program is to quantify the risk status for medication adherence in a cohort of Australian patients diagnosed with schizophrenia.

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
* Clinical diagnosis of schizophrenia or schizoaffective disorder according to DSM-IV * Currently treated in an outpatient clinic * Able to provide informed consent * Concurrent enrolment in clinical trials is acceptable * Have completed all questions on the Drug Attitude Inventory (DAI-10) and Medication Adherence Rating Scale (MARS) survey
